| Tucked away down a narrow winding lane lies the gem that is Cyfie Farm. Perched above the Vyrnwy Valley this is a Guesthouse in a class of its own. Two 5-star self-catering cottages are available too.
The guest accommodation is 3 self contained suites in a converted stable and corn store attached to the beautiful 17th century Welsh longhouse. All suites have their own private sitting rooms, 2 with log fires. Two have separate entrances and kitchenettes and the third is accessed from the farmhouse kitchen and has the use of the farmhouse utility room. . Pine furniture and exposed beams create a country feel in comfortable surroundings where guests are encouraged to relax and enjoy the peace all day. Each room has an immensely comfortable bed with crisp linen, spacious bathrooms with fluffy bathrobes, towels and luxury toiletries..
Surrounded by 20 acres of garden and farmland, the views are stunning - best enjoyed from the hot tub and sauna overlooking the valley - and this peaceful and remote retreat is uninterrupted by traffic noise.
Breakfast, and dinner if required, is served in the house using local, seasonal produce and the water is supplied from the farm's own spring. Cyfie Farm offers a particularly relaxed atmosphere whilst maintaining a reputation for fine food, comfort and attention to detail.

Self Catering Cottages
2 luxury 5-star self-catering cottages available: Sheep Dip Cottage and Shepherd's Watch.
Each cottage sleeps up to 4 people and have been lovingly restored, retaining many of the 17th century characteristics.
Oak beams, flagged floors, , a log fire, galleried features and underfloor heating. There are 2 bedrooms and 2 bathrooms/en suites in each.
The beds are spectacular; with a reclaimed oak, king-sized, extra long double bed in Sheep Dip Cottage to a Gothic style king-sized wrought iron bed in Shepherd's Watch. Sheep Dip also has 2 twin 19th Century antique walnut beds and the en suite has a steam shower cubicle for a Turkish Bath experience. all of the colours and fabrics have been carefully chosen to provide a luxurious backdrop.
Flat-screen TVs, audio systems and all heating are included to enhance your experience. The fully equipped kitchens have every modern convenience too.
